类 GrpcConnection

java.lang.Object
com.alibaba.nacos.core.remote.Connection
com.alibaba.nacos.core.remote.grpc.GrpcConnection
所有已实现的接口:
com.alibaba.nacos.api.remote.Requester

public class GrpcConnection extends Connection
grpc connection.
版本:
$Id: GrpcConnection.java, v 0.1 2020年07月13日 7:26 PM liuzunfei Exp $
作者:
liuzunfei
  • 构造器详细资料

    • GrpcConnection

      public GrpcConnection(ConnectionMeta metaInfo, io.grpc.stub.StreamObserver streamObserver, io.grpc.netty.shaded.io.netty.channel.Channel channel)
  • 方法详细资料

    • request

      public com.alibaba.nacos.api.remote.response.Response request(com.alibaba.nacos.api.remote.request.Request request, long timeoutMills) throws com.alibaba.nacos.api.exception.NacosException
      抛出:
      com.alibaba.nacos.api.exception.NacosException
    • requestFuture

      public com.alibaba.nacos.api.remote.RequestFuture requestFuture(com.alibaba.nacos.api.remote.request.Request request) throws com.alibaba.nacos.api.exception.NacosException
      抛出:
      com.alibaba.nacos.api.exception.NacosException
    • asyncRequest

      public void asyncRequest(com.alibaba.nacos.api.remote.request.Request request, com.alibaba.nacos.api.remote.RequestCallBack requestCallBack) throws com.alibaba.nacos.api.exception.NacosException
      抛出:
      com.alibaba.nacos.api.exception.NacosException
    • close

      public void close()
    • isConnected

      public boolean isConnected()
      从类复制的说明: Connection
      check is connected.
      指定者:
      isConnected 在类中 Connection
      返回:
      if connection or not,check the inner connection is active.